Pair Trading with Firefly AB and CTT Systems
The main advantage of trading using opposite Firefly AB and CTT Systems positions is that it hedges away some unsystematic risk. Because of two separate transactions, even if Firefly AB position performs unexpectedly, CTT Systems can make up some of the losses. Pair trading also minimizes risk from directional movements in the market.
